(c)
To explain which experiment would you consider the stronger design and why.
(c)
Answer to Problem 1E
The matched pair design is considered to be stronger.
Explanation of Solution
In the question agricultural researchers wants to design an experiment to find out can a food additive increase egg production. They have two kinds of feed: the regular feed and the new feed with the additive. Thus, by looking at the two designs in the above part (a) and (b), that is to design an experiment that will require a two sample t procedure to analyse the results and second one to design an experiment that will require a matched-pairs t procedure to analyse the results, we can say that we would consider the design of the matched pairs the stronger design because the hens vary in their egg production and matched pairs will help with that.
